With Le Mans 4 weeks behind us, the European Le Mans Series gets ready for its third round of the 2015 season at the Red Bull Ring in Spielberg, Austria. No less than 12 LMP2's will race on Sunday, the biggest LMP2 grid so far this season. Thiriet by TDS will be eager to score a second win after their class perfomance at Imola and build up their 2-point lead in the championship over Greaves racing. SMP Racing lines up both of its BR-01 prototypes, as does Ibanez Racing with their Oreca 03-Nissans. The Algarve Pro Ligier-Nissan makes its debut in the championship. Murphy Prototypes will be on a high after their 5th place in Le Mans and their great race at Imola in May. Completing the grid will be Jota Sport, currently third, 9 points behind Thiriet, Krohn Racing (with Julien Canal replacing Ozz Negri), Pegasus Racing and Eurasia Motorsport. In LMP3 only four cars (all Ginetta's) will be on the grid in Austria.
Team LNT will race 2 cars (one of them borrowed from the University of Bolton Team), Villorba Corse and SVK by Speed Factory will complete the grid. The season's two final races at Le Castellet and Estoril should have an increased grid for LMP3 with the debut of several new teams and hopefully the highly anticipated and blimingly quick Ligier JS P3 from Onroak Automotive. The paddock is buzzing with new and existing teams showing interest in LMP3, this might be a class to watch in the near future. In LMGTE and GTC there are no changes to both starting grids. The battle in GTE will be tight again with AT Racing defending their victory in Imola over Proton Competition's Porsche RSR. Gulf Racing UK with the blue/orange 911 RSR will be ready to get on the podium again, defending their second place in the championship ! The BMW Z4 GTE by Marc VDS scored two 4th places in Silverstone and Imola, will they be able to squeeze themselves between the Ferrari and Porsches of the championship's leading teams ? GTC has a 5 car entry with the Thiriet BMW Z4 and the Massive Motorsports Aston Vantage getting a BOP with a 20 kg weight reduction. The 3 AF Corse Ferrari's will race in the same spec as the precious races. With the Formula Renault 3.5 series, 2 races in the TCR touring car championship and a Red Bull Nascar show on Sunday, this weekend will be a true festival of motorsport. Endurance racing, formula racing and touringcars in a wonderfull setting under the sun, all set for a great weekend. And above all, entrance is free for all spectators, including the grandstands, autograph session and lots of animation in the paddock.
